| Kaiser Ghidorah (alternately Keizer Ghidorah. Officially, TOHO refers to him as Monster X II) is the most recent, and most powerful, incarnation of Godzilla’s longtime nemesis, King Ghidorah. Unlike Ghidorah’s previous incarnations (save for Death Ghidorah of the Mothra Trilogy) Kaiser Ghidorah is quadrapedal. Much like his older forms, Kaiser Ghidorah stands significantly taller than Godzilla when they battle. Kaiser Ghidorah’s skin is the traditional golden colour, with the occasional tinge of blue and his eyes are sunken deep into his heads, red and pupiless. In a change from the older incarnations of Ghidorah, Kaiser Ghidorah has rather small wings, as opposed to the intimidating and incredibly large wings of his older incarnations. Kaiser Ghidorah, however, returns to his evil roots, changing back form his benevolent portrayal in Godzilla, Mothra and King Ghidorah: Giant Monster All Out Attack. Kaiser Ghidorah evolved from of the skeletal Monster X, leading to some speculation that Monster X may be a type of chrysalis stage for Ghidorah. After Godzilla and Monster X battled to a stand still, Monster X transformed into Ghidorah, to a choral of lightning. Godzilla, seemingly undaunted at the titanic beast that appeared before him, fired his atomic ray immediately after Ghidorah rose. Kaiser Ghidorah fired his gravity rays, locking his beam with Godzilla’s. Unlike when Godzilla and Monster X’s beams collided, Ghidorah and Godzilla began to push against the others beam, Ghidorah proving too powerful for Godzilla. Godzilla is thrown to the ground, left at the mercy of Kaiser Ghidorah and his devastating rays. Ghidorah smashes Godzilla across the destroyed landscape, sending him crashing into crumbling buildings and slamming him to the ground. Eventually, Ghidorah uses his immense weight to crush Godzilla, weakening him so he can no longer fight back. Ghidorah then reaches out and seizes Godzilla in his mouths, lifting him high off the ground. The mighty dragon then leeches the life from Godzilla’s body, rendering him unconscious, or possibly dead. It is at this point when the mutant soldier Ozaki, realizing Godzilla is their only hope at destroying Kaiser Ghidorah, leaps into the main firing chair of the warship Gotengo and transfers his “Kaiser” energy to Godzilla. The energy awakens Godzilla once more, endowing him with immense power. Godzilla proceeds to turn the tables on Kaiser Ghidorah, decapitating his middle head with his atomic breath and cutting his right head off by redirecting one of Ghidorah’s own rays. He then pummels Ghidorah and hurls him to the sky, firing a ultra-powerful spiral ray that sends Kaiser Ghidorah flying into the stratosphere, where he explodes and is destroyed forever. The Kaiser Ghidorah incarnation marks the first time in his history that his Gravity Rays/Gravity Bolts beam weapon has actually disrupted gravity to be used as an attack. The older incarnations of Ghidorah’s gravity bolts used to use entirely concussive force to attack his opponents, whereas Kaiser Ghidorah’s rays act as a form of “tractor beam”, allowing Ghidorah to lift his opponent and move them to his will. There is fan speculation and debate as to whether Godzilla was simply rendered unconscious or actually killed when he was seized in Ghidorah’s Energy Bite. Many believe Godzilla was simply too weak to fight back, but others say that he was actually dead. If it were truly the latter, it would solidify Kaiser Ghidorah’s place as Godzilla most powerful opponent to date.
